Overview

NJPW Power Struggle ~ Super Junior Tag League 2024 was a professional wrestling event promoted by New Japan Pro-Wrestling (NJPW) that took place on November 4, 2024, at the EDION Arena Osaka in Osaka, Japan, and was headlined by Zack Sabre Jr. (c) vs. Shingo Takagi for the IWGP World Heavyweight Championship.
